



全文预览已结束
下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
让有理想的人更加卓越!【例1】(2009年全国计算机学科联考专业基础综合卷第12题,2分): 一个C语言程序在一台32位机器上运行。程序中定义了三个变量x、y、z,其中x和z是int型,y为short型。当x=127,y=-9时,执行赋值语句z=x+y后,x、y、z的值分别是AX=0000007FH,y=FFF9H,z=00000076HBX=0000007FH,y=FFF9H,z=FFFF0076HCX=0000007FH,y=FFF7H,z=FFFF0076H DX=0000007FH,y=FFF7H,z=00000076H【解析】 D。本题目涉及知识点如下:(1) 十进制数转换为二进制数:十进制转二进制的方法为整数部分除2取余倒计数,小数部分乘2取整正计数。9 / 2 . 1= 4 / 2 . 0= 2 / 2 . 0= 1/ 2 . 19=1001B127 / 2 . 1= 63 / 2 . 1= 31 / 2 . 1= 15 / 2 . 1=7 / 2 . 1= 3 / 2 .1= 1 / 2 . 1127= 1111111B(2)转成32位补码127补=1111111B补=+0000000000000000000000001111111B补=00000000000000000000000001111111B=0007FH-9补=-1001B补=-0000000000000000000000000001001B补=11111111111111111111111111110111B=0FFF7H(3)求x+y的真值及补码 127+(-9)=118118补=1110110B补=+0000000000000000000000001110110B补=00000000000000000000000001110110B=00076H 或补码直接求和:0007FH+0FFF7H =00076H答案为D。【例2】(2009年全国计算机学科联考专业基础综合卷第13题,2分): 浮点数加减运算过程一般包括对阶、尾数运算、规格化、舍入和判溢出等步骤。设浮点数的阶码和尾数均采用补码表示,且位数分别为5位和7位(均含2位符号位)。若有两个数X=2729/32,Y=255/8,则用浮点加法计算X+Y的最终结果是A:001111100010 B: 001110100010 C:010000010001 D: 发生溢出【解析】 D。本题目涉及知识点如下:(1)浮点数表示:设X=Mx * 2Ex , Y=My * 2Ey Mx 补=29/32补= +0.11101B补=00 11101B My 补=5/8补= +0. 101B补=+0. 10100B补=00 10100B Ex 补= 7补= +111B补=00 111B Ey 补= 5补= +101B补=00 101B X: 00 111B 00 11101B Y: 00 101B 00 10100B (2)对阶 Ex Ey ,所以Y: 00 111B 00 00101 00B,My 补= 00 00101 00B,Ey 补=00 111B (3)尾数求和 Mx+ My 补= 01 00010B (4)右规 尾数的和溢出,需要通过右移进行规格化,但是当前阶码已经为最大值00 111B,无法通过右移进行规格化。 (5)溢出判断 无法通过右移完成结果的规格化,运算结果溢出,答案为D。【例3】(2009年全国计算机学科联考专业基础综合卷第16题,2分):某机器字长16位,主存按字节编址,转移指令采用相对寻址,由两个字节组成,第一字节为操作码字段,第二字节为相对位移量字段。假定取指令时,每取一个字节PC自动加1。若某转移指令所在主存地址为2000H,相对位移量字段的内容为06H,则该转移指令成功转以后的目标地址是A:2006H B:2007H C:2008H D:2009H【解析】本题目涉及知识点如下:(1) 由题意,转移指令由两个字节组成,所以取入转移指令后PC的值加2,为2002H。(2) 相对寻址的目标地址=PC的值+指令中给定的偏移量=2001H+06H=2008H。 答案为C。【例4】(2012年全国计算机学科联考专业基础综合卷第18题,2分):某计算机的控制器采用微程序控制方式,微指令中的操作控制字段采用字段直接编码法,共有33个微命令,构成5个互斥类,分别包含7、3、12、5和6个微命令,则操作控制字段至少有 A:5位 B:6位 C:15位 D:33位【解析】本题目涉及知识点如下:(1) 微操作类型相容性微操作:同时或同一个CPU周期内可以并行执行的微操作。相斥性微操作:不能同时或在同一个CPU周期内并行执行的微操作(2) 微命令编码 直接控制法:微指令控制字段的一种编码方法,每个微命令占一位。直接编码法:相斥的n个微命令可以采用编码法表示,占log2n+1位。混合编码法:相斥微命令采用直接编码法,相容微命令采用直接控制法。(3) 7个互斥的微命令采用直接编码法至少需要log27+1位,即3位。3个互斥的微命令采用直接编码法至少需要log23+1位,即2位。12个互斥的微命令采用直接编码法至少需要log212+1位,即4位。5个互斥的微命令采用直接编码法至少需要log25+1位,即3位。6个互斥的微命令采用直接编码法至少需要log26+1位,即3位。 至少需要3+2+4+3+3=15位。答案为C。【例5】 (2009年全国计算机学科联考专业基础综合卷第44题,13分):某计算机的字长16位,采用16位定长指令字结构,部分数据通路结构如图5-15所示,图中所有控制信号为1时表示有效,为0时表示无效,例如控制信号MDRinE为1表示允许数据从DB打入MDR,MDRin为1表示允许数据从内总线打入MDR。假设MAR的输出一直处于使能状态。加法指令“ADD (R1),R0”的功能为R0 +(R1) (R1),即将R0中的数据与R1的内容所指主存单元的数据相加,并将结果送入R1的内容所指主存单元中保存。至指令译码部件PC+1IRinIRPCinPCoutPCACoutAddACinACAinAR1outR0outR1inR1R0inR0内总线MDRoutMARinMARMDRoutEMDRinMDRDBCBAB存储器(M)MemR MemW Data AddrMDRinE表5-1给出了上述指令取指和译码阶段每个节拍(时钟周期)的功能和有效控制信号,请按表中描述方式用表格列出指令执行阶段每个节拍的功能和有效控制信号。表5-1节拍功能表时钟功能有效控制信号C1MAR(PC)PCout, MARinC2MDRM(MAR) PC(PC)+1MemR, MDRinEPC+1C3IR(MDR)MDRout, IRinC4指令译码无【解析】 本题目涉及知识点如下:(1) 寻址方式:寄存器间接寻址 由题目已知条件,加法指令“ADD (R1),R0”中R1为寄存器间接寻址,其内容为内存地址,R0为寄存器直接寻址,其内容为操作数据。(2) 数据通路和指令功能 由题目已知条件,加法指令“ADD (R1),R0”的功能为R0 +(R1) (R1),即将R0中的数据与R1的内容所指主存单元的数据相加,并将结果送入R1的内容所指 主存单元中保存。 由题目给定的数据通路结构可知,完成指令“ADD (R1),R0”的功能,需要先将R1的内容作为内存地址,读取该单元内容到CPU的MDR中,为完成加法运算,读入的数据还需要从MDR送入运算器的A中,然后和R0中的数据求和,再将结果写入R1间接寻址的内存单元。(3) 控制信号 R1的内容作为内存地址,功能为MAR(R1),所需控制信号为R1out, MARin。读取内存单元内容到MDR中,功能为MDRM(MAR),所需控制信号为MemR, MDRinE。 R0内容送CPU的A中,功能为AR0,所需控制信号为R0out, Ain。完成加法运算,功能为AC(MDR)+(A),所需控制信号为MDRout, Add,ACin。AC中的数据送MDR,功能为MDR(AC),所需控制信号为ACout, MDRin。结果写入R1间接寻址的内存单元,功能为M(MAR)(MDR),所需控制信号为MDRoutE, MemW。具体节拍功能序列见表5-2:表5-2节拍功能表时钟功能有效控制信号C5MAR(R1)R1out, MARinC6MDRM(MAR)AR0MemR, MDRinER0out, AinC7AC(MDR)+(A)MDRout, Add,ACinC8MDR(AC)ACout, MDRinC9M(MAR)(MDR)MDRoutE, MemW总结计算机组成原理课程内容总体偏抽象,这个复习过程应该以课本内容为主,输入理解各部分基本原理。课本知识做到不漏、不偏。重点章节内容必须熟练掌握课本每一句话的含义,准确把握知识点之间的联系。基础阶段的复习方法:整合各章知识点,逐一认真复习,课本例题和课后作业认真理解、
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 三基三严心肺复苏课件
- 2025-2030中国干制蔬菜类制品产业需求动态及盈利预测报告
- 思维拓展:思品面试题目及答案衍生主题探讨
- 小兔和小猪的课件
- 小儿静脉输液
- 大班体育教案摘果果
- 大学生调查方案
- 大学生就业实习工作内容总结
- 大学生个人实习总结
- 三会一课教学课件
- DB43T 1393-2018 矿山地质环境保护与恢复治理验收标准
- 从隋唐盛世到五代十国课件
- 医疗器械销售代表岗位招聘面试题及回答建议2025年
- 村庄保洁服务投标方案(技术方案)
- VTE防控管理相关制度(VTE患者管理与随访的相关管理制度)
- 2023年辽宁省中考语文现代文阅读之记叙文阅读7篇
- 氧化铝制取全套教学教程整套课件全书电子教案
- 2024年资金分析师职业鉴定考试复习题库资料(浓缩500题)
- 项目部地震应急演练方案
- 班级管理教育调查报告(3篇模板)
- 2024年度医疗器械监督管理条例培训课件
评论
0/150
提交评论